  • Aspects of Semantic Opposition in English
  • Written by author Arthur Mettinger
  • Published by Oxford University Press, USA, March 1994
  • Antonymy is recognized as an important type of meaning relation in natural language, yet there are very few detailed empirical studies of the topic. Through an analysis of a corpus of forty-three contemporary English-language novels, Mettinger isolates te
